See out the list of English boys names letters I to L including names such as Jack, Joe and Leo:
Name | Description | Popularity |
Ike | A form of Isaac. | * |
Ingram | Ingram from medieval name Engelram. | * |
Irving | Local place name in near Dumfries. | * |
Isaiah | Biblical name meaning God is salvation. | * |
Ivor | This male name means bowed warrior. | * |
Jack | The English name is a pet form of John. | ***** |
Jackie | Pet form of Jack. | ** |
Jackson | Jackson means the son of Jack. | *** |
Jacob | Biblical name from the Hebrew name Yaakov. | ***** |
Jake | English name derived from Jack. | ***** |
Jamie | A pet name for James | ***** |
James | Biblical name from the Latin name Iacomus. | ***** |
Jarvis | English name from the Norman name Gervaise. | ** |
Jason | From Greek mythology Iason. | *** |
Jasper | A bearer of treasure (as in the 3 wise men) | ** |
Jed | Short for Jedidiah. | * |
Jeff | Pet form of Jeffrey. | ** |
Jeffrey | English name from Geoffrey | *** |
Jefferson | Son of Jeffrey. | * |
Jenson | Means son of Jens. | **** |
Jeremy | English version of Jeremiah. | *** |
Jermaine | Male name from Germaine. | ** |
Jerome | means holy name. | ** |
Jerrard | Jerrard from the name Gerard. | ** |
Jerrold | Jerrold from Gerald. | * |
Jerry | Pet form of Jeremy. | ** |
Jesse | Meaning gift. | * |
Jethro | Derived from the Hebrew name Ithra. | * |
Jim | Pet form of the English boy’s name James. | *** |
Jimmy | Jimmy from Jim. | ** |
Joe | Short for Joseph. | **** |
Jody | Jody can be a male name but it’s more commonly female name. | * |
Joey | Pet form of Joe. | **** |
John | Anglicised version of Ioannes. | ***** |
Johnathan | Variant of Jonathan. | * |
Johnny | Pet form of John. | *** |
Jordan | Jordan from the river Jordan. | *** |
Joseph | From Yosef meaning God will make you fertile. | **** |
Josh | Pet form of Joshua. | **** |
Judd | Judd pet form of Jordan. | * |
Jude | Jude from the name Judas. | **** |
Julian | English version of yhe name Julius. | *** |
Justin | English version of the name Justus. | *** |
Keith | English name from the place in East Lothian. | *** |
Kelly | Kelly is an English boy’s name for Ceallagh. | ** |
Kelsey | Means ship’ s victory. | * |
Kelvin | From the river that branches into the Clyde. | ** |
Kemp | Means athlete or wrestler. | * |
Ken | Pet form of Kenneth. | *** |
Kendrick | Origin unknown. | ** |
Kenelm | Means bold helmet protector. | ** |
Kennard | Kennard from the middle ages- could mean royal guard. | ** |
Kenneth | From the Gaelic names Cinaed and Cainnech. | ** |
Kent | Someone from Kent in England. | ** |
Kenton | Kenton local places in England. | * |
Kermit | Means son of Dermot. | * |
Kerr | Someone who dwells by brushwood | * |
Kerry | From the Irish county of Kerry. | *** |
Kevin | From Gaelic name Caimhin. | *** |
King | From the name of the monarch. | * |
Kingsley | From places in Hampshire and Staffordshire. Means old wood. | * |
Kit | Pet name of Christopher. | ** |
Kyran | English spelling of Kieran. | * |
Lacey | People from Lassy in France. | ** |
Lambert | Lambert means famous land. | ** |
Lance | Lance from the weapon a lance. | *** |
Lancelot | Celtic origin. | ** |
Larry | Pet form of Lawrence. | *** |
Laurel | Meaning a tree. | ** |
Laurence | A person from Laurentius. | ** |
Lawrence | Anglicised form of Laurance. | ** |
Lee | Means wood or clearing. | *** |
Leighton | Means leek settlement. | ** |
Leland | Someone from a fallow land. | * |
Len | Len is short for Leonard. | *** |
Lennard | English spelling of Leonard. | ** |
Lenny | Variation of Leonard. | ** |
Leo | Leo means a lion. | ***** |
Leon | A form of Leo. | **** |
Leonard | Meaning lion. | ** |
Leopold | Meaning brave people. | ** |
Leroy | Means the king. | ** |
Les | Short for Lesley | ** |
Lesley | Lesley name variant of Leslie | ** |
Lester | name is from the English city Leicester. | * |
Lewie | name is from the English city Leicester. | * |
Lex | Pet name for Alex. | ** |
Lincoln | From the English city Lincoln. | * |
Linden | Means the lime tree. | * |
Lindon | Variation of Lindon. | ** |
Linsay | Linsay wetlands belonging to Lincon. | * |
Linford | A mix of the words lime tree and ford. | * |
Linton | Place names in England. | * |
Lionel | From the name Leon. | ** |
Lonnie | Origin unknown. | *** |
Lorne | Origin unknown. | * |
Louie | A variant of Louis. | **** |
Lovell | Means club wolf. | ** |
Lucas | A form of Luke. | ***** |
Ludo | Pet form of Ludovic. | ** |
Luke | Luke from name Loukas. | ***** |
Luther | Means people army. | * |
Lyndon | A place in Leicestershire. | ** |
Lyle | Someone who live on an island. | ** |
